Types of support available
In Farmington Hills, survivors of domestic violence can access a range of support services including:
- Lawyers: Legal professionals who specialize in domestic violence cases can guide you through your rights and options.
- Therapists: Mental health professionals offer counseling and support to help you heal emotionally.
- Shelters: Safe spaces that provide temporary housing and support services for those fleeing abusive situations.
- Hotlines: Confidential services that offer immediate support, information, and resources at any time.
- Legal aid: Organizations that provide free or low-cost legal assistance to those in need.

Safety planning basics
Creating a safety plan is an important step for anyone experiencing domestic violence. Consider the following basics:
- Identify a safe place to go in case of an emergency.
- Keep important documents and essentials easily accessible.
- Establish a code word with trusted friends or family for discreet help.
- Plan how to leave safely and when to do so.
